1) When Siddartha went to his father to ask if he could leave to go to the Samanas and learn about spiritual fulfillment. He remained standing until his father responded an answer to him, because he wished to get a direct response and he didn't leave because he wished to respect his father.
But, in the end, his father has no choice but to let Siddartha go because he has "already left". This means that although his physical body is present, his body mentally is gone and has moved on with the Samanas. His father was very against Siddartha leaving, because it was like leaving his family and religion to understand another, and his father was a religious leader as well.
